About 4-butyl-1,5-dipropyltriazole

4-butyl-1,5-dipropyltriazole (PubChem CID 69382498) has the molecular formula C12H23N3 and a molecular weight of 209.34 g/mol. Its IUPAC name is 4-butyl-1,5-dipropyltriazole.
